Possible Causes of Water Damage to Carpets

Water damage to carpets in Manchester can happen unexpectedly due to various reasons. A burst pipe or leaking appliance often leads to significant water accumulation, seeping into your carpets and causing extensive damage. Additionally, heavy rainfall or storm flooding can overwhelm your home’s drainage systems, leading to water intrusion inside your living spaces.

Over time, unnoticed leaks from roofs or windows can also let water seep into carpets, creating a damp environment that fosters mold growth. In some cases, plumbing failures behind walls can result in hidden water leaks, gradually soaking your carpets and creating a costly issue if not promptly addressed.

How Our Experts Can Restore Your Carpets

Our team begins with a thorough inspection to assess the extent of the water damage and identify all affected areas. We then implement professional water extraction techniques to remove standing water swiftly and efficiently.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and mold development.

Next, we use advanced drying equipment, including industrial-strength dehumidifiers and high-velocity air movers, to thoroughly dry your carpets and surrounding materials. Our experts monitor moisture levels continuously to ensure complete drying and prevent secondary issues like mold growth.

Once the carpets are fully dried, we perform deep cleaning and sanitation to remove dirt, debris, and potential contaminants. If necessary, we can also oversee carpet repairs or replacements to restore your home’s comfort and safety. Our goal is to return your carpets to their pre-damage condition with minimal disruption to your daily routine.

Frequently Asked Questions

How quickly should I act if my carpet gets soaked with water?

It’s best to act immediately. The sooner our experts arrive, the better we can prevent mold growth, structural damage, and permanent carpet staining. Contact us as soon as possible at (734) 627-6598 for rapid response.

Will my carpet be salvageable after water damage?

Many carpets can be dried and restored depending on the extent of the damage. Our professionals evaluate each case carefully and use advanced techniques to salvage as much of your carpet as possible. Sometimes, cleaning and repairs can avoid full replacement.

How long does the carpet drying process typically take?

The drying process varies based on the amount of water, carpet type, and affected materials. Usually, it takes between 24 to 48 hours. Our team monitors moisture levels closely to ensure thorough drying without prolonging the process.

Can mold develop after water damage to my carpets?

Yes, mold can develop within 24-48 hours if carpets are not properly dried and cleaned. That’s why quick action and professional restoration are essential to prevent mold growth and protect your family’s health.

What should I do before professional help arrives?
